In Respect to Egotism

Discover the depths of American Romanticism in "In Respect to Egotism" by Professor Porte, published by Cambridge University Press in 1991. This thought-provoking study spans 336 pages and delivers insightful reassessments of both well-known and lesser-known texts within the genre. Professor Porte's engaging analysis invites readers to explore the complexities of egotism in literature, making it a must-read for students, scholars, and enthusiasts alike.
